Bobcat T100 vs Case SV280: Which Is the Better Value?
The Bobcat T100 averages $34,652 CAD at auction, compared to $32,066 for the Case SV280. That's a $2,586 difference. Based on 58 verified Canadian auction results tracked by TrackCheck, here's the full breakdown.
The Verdict
Both machines are competitively priced with only a $2,586 difference. Your decision should come down to brand preference, dealer proximity, and specific feature needs rather than price alone.

What are the key differences between T100 and SV280?
- Price: The SV280 is $2,586 cheaper on average (7% savings).
- Track Type: T100 is a compact track loader (CTL) while SV280 is a wheeled skid steer (SSL). CTLs have better traction on soft ground; wheeled units are faster and cheaper to maintain.
- Usage: Used T100s average 324 hours while SV280s average 1,716 hours.

How do T100 and SV280 prices compare by year?
| Year | Bobcat T100 | Case SV280 |
|---|---|---|
| 2025 | $41,444 (4) | — |
| 2024 | $21,279 (2) | — |
| 2023 | $17,243 (3) | — |
| 2022 | $37,371 (5) | — |
| 2021 | $43,389 (6) | — |
| 2020 | $27,546 (2) | $42,651 (2) |
| 2019 | — | $10,258 (2) |
| 2018 | — | $12,750 (2) |
| 2017 | — | $35,353 (10) |
| 2016 | — | $29,336 (6) |
| 2015 | — | $33,922 (12) |
Prices in CAD. Numbers in parentheses are sample size. Lower price highlighted.
How do T100 and SV280 prices compare by hours?
| Hours | Bobcat T100 | Case SV280 |
|---|---|---|
| 0-999 hrs | $34,652 (22) | $44,970 (10) |
| 1,000-1,999 hrs | — | $31,384 (6) |
| 2,000-2,999 hrs | — | $30,267 (14) |
| 3,000-3,999 hrs | — | $18,028 (4) |
